在云计算系统中,提供云+端,云计算系统中广泛使用的数据存储系统有

欧气 3 0

《云计算系统中的数据存储系统:云 + 端的全方位剖析》

一、引言

在当今数字化时代,云计算系统已经成为企业和个人处理数据的重要基础设施,云计算系统中广泛使用的数据存储系统在支持海量数据的存储、管理和访问方面发挥着关键作用,这些存储系统不仅要满足云服务提供商自身的数据管理需求,还要为众多的云端用户提供高效、可靠、安全的数据存储解决方案,这其中“云 + 端”的模式是一个重要的考量因素。

二、云计算系统中数据存储系统的类型

1、分布式文件系统(DFS)

在云计算系统中,提供云+端,云计算系统中广泛使用的数据存储系统有

图片来源于网络,如有侵权联系删除

- 在云计算环境下,分布式文件系统是一种常见的数据存储方式,例如Ceph分布式文件系统,它采用了对象存储、块存储和文件系统存储的统一架构,在云 + 端的模式中,Ceph可以在云端提供大规模的存储资源池,对于云服务提供商来说,Ceph的分布式特性使其能够轻松扩展存储容量,通过添加新的存储节点来满足不断增长的数据存储需求,在端的方面,客户端可以通过Ceph提供的接口方便地访问存储在云端的文件,一个小型企业使用基于Ceph的云存储服务,其员工可以在不同的终端设备(如笔记本电脑、平板电脑等)上上传和下载文件,Ceph能够保证数据的一致性和可靠性。

- 另一个典型的分布式文件系统是GlusterFS,它将多个存储服务器的存储空间整合在一起,形成一个统一的全局命名空间,从云的角度看,云服务提供商可以利用GlusterFS构建高可用的存储集群,以提供给多个用户使用,在端的层面,用户可以像使用本地文件系统一样访问云端的GlusterFS存储,无论是在Windows还是Linux操作系统下的终端设备,这种无缝的云 + 端体验得益于GlusterFS的分布式架构和灵活的客户端支持。

2、对象存储系统

- Amazon S3是对象存储系统在云计算中的杰出代表,在云的方面,S3为全球众多企业和开发者提供了几乎无限的存储容量,它通过将数据存储为对象的方式,每个对象都有唯一的标识符、元数据和数据内容,对于云服务提供商,S3的架构易于管理和扩展,在端的应用场景中,各种移动应用和物联网设备都可以将数据存储到S3上,一个智能摄像头作为终端设备,可以将拍摄的视频数据直接上传到Amazon S3云存储中,开发人员可以通过简单的API调用在云 + 端之间进行数据交互,实现诸如视频监控数据的存储、分析等功能。

- 国内的阿里云对象存储OSS也具有类似的特性,OSS支持多种数据访问方式,从网页端的直接上传下载到移动端的SDK集成,在云的基础设施构建上,OSS采用了分布式存储和冗余备份技术,确保数据的高可靠性,对于终端用户,无论是个人开发者开发的小型应用还是大型企业的移动办公应用,都可以方便地将数据存储在OSS上,实现云 + 端的数据流通。

3、关系型数据库管理系统(RDBMS)在云计算中的应用

- 像MySQL、PostgreSQL等关系型数据库在云计算系统中也有广泛的应用,以MySQL为例,在云环境下,云服务提供商可以提供MySQL数据库实例作为一种云服务,在云的层面,通过集群技术和资源分配优化,可以同时为多个用户提供数据库服务,从端的角度看,企业的各种应用程序(如客户关系管理系统、企业资源规划系统等)可以通过网络连接到云端的MySQL数据库,这些应用程序在终端设备(如台式机、服务器等)上运行,将数据存储、查询和管理任务交给云端的MySQL数据库,这样既减轻了端设备的存储和计算负担,又利用了云的强大计算和存储资源,实现了云 + 端的协同工作。

在云计算系统中,提供云+端,云计算系统中广泛使用的数据存储系统有

图片来源于网络,如有侵权联系删除

- PostgreSQL在云计算中的应用也有其独特之处,它支持高级的数据类型和复杂的查询功能,在云的部署中,云服务提供商可以针对不同用户的需求定制PostgreSQL数据库服务,对于端用户,特别是那些对数据安全性和完整性要求较高的企业用户,他们可以在自己的终端设备上开发与PostgreSQL数据库交互的应用程序,确保数据在云 + 端之间的安全传输和有效利用。

三、数据存储系统在云 + 端模式下的关键特性

1、可靠性与可用性

- 在云计算系统中,数据存储系统必须保证高可靠性,以分布式文件系统为例,通过数据冗余技术,如副本机制,将数据存储在多个节点上,在云的层面,即使某个节点出现故障,其他节点上的副本仍然可以保证数据的可用性,对于端用户来说,这种可靠性意味着他们可以随时访问自己存储在云端的数据,无论是在网络状况不佳还是云服务提供商内部出现局部故障的情况下,在一个分布式文件系统中,数据被复制3份存储在不同的节点上,当一个端用户请求读取数据时,如果其中一个节点无法响应,系统可以自动从其他副本所在节点获取数据并返回给用户。

- 可用性也是一个关键特性,云服务提供商需要确保存储系统能够24/7不间断运行,从端的角度看,用户希望能够在任何时间、任何地点访问自己的数据,这就要求数据存储系统具有良好的负载均衡机制,能够根据用户的请求分布合理地分配资源,在对象存储系统中,当多个端用户同时上传或下载数据时,系统能够自动将请求分配到负载较轻的存储节点上,提高整体的可用性。

2、安全性

- 云 + 端模式下的数据存储系统面临着诸多安全挑战,在云的层面,数据存储系统需要防止数据泄露、恶意攻击等安全威胁,采用加密技术对存储在云端的数据进行加密,无论是文件系统中的文件还是数据库中的数据,云服务提供商通常会提供加密密钥管理服务,确保只有授权的用户能够解密数据,在端的方面,安全同样重要,端设备需要对用户身份进行认证,防止未经授权的访问,在移动应用连接到云端存储系统时,通过用户名和密码、指纹识别或面部识别等多因素认证方式,确保只有合法用户能够操作云端数据。

在云计算系统中,提供云+端,云计算系统中广泛使用的数据存储系统有

图片来源于网络,如有侵权联系删除

- 数据的访问控制也是安全性的重要组成部分,云服务提供商可以根据用户的权限设置,允许或禁止用户对特定数据的访问,在端设备上,应用程序也需要遵循这些访问控制规则,确保数据的安全性在云 + 端之间得到统一的保障。

3、可扩展性

- 随着云计算用户数量的增加和数据量的爆炸式增长,数据存储系统的可扩展性至关重要,在云的层面,分布式存储系统可以通过添加新的存储节点来轻松扩展存储容量,当一个云服务提供商的对象存储系统的存储需求接近饱和时,他们可以简单地购买新的存储服务器并将其加入到存储集群中,而不需要对整个系统进行大规模的重新架构,在端的方面,可扩展性体现在不同类型和数量的端设备能够接入到云存储系统中,无论是少量的高端服务器还是大量的物联网传感器设备,都应该能够与云存储系统进行有效的数据交互,并且随着端设备数量的增加,云存储系统能够自适应地调整资源分配,满足数据存储和访问的需求。

四、结论

云计算系统中的数据存储系统在云 + 端模式下发挥着不可替代的作用,不同类型的数据存储系统,如分布式文件系统、对象存储系统和关系型数据库管理系统,都在云服务提供商和端用户之间构建了高效的数据存储和交互桥梁,这些存储系统的可靠性、安全性和可扩展性等关键特性确保了云 + 端模式能够满足不同场景下的需求,从企业的大规模数据存储和管理到个人用户的移动数据存储,随着云计算技术的不断发展,数据存储系统也将不断创新和优化,为云 + 端的协同发展提供更加强有力的支持。

标签: #云计算 #数据存储系统 #广泛使用

  • 评论列表

留言评论